Output 5e189999c981d54ac553076f887d24b7a196415bde28d3e26c02fd0467921f9e:1

value
1953434
script pubkey
OP_0 OP_PUSHBYTES_20 dd20288199e3387ddf3d88915d8afa793e7877c6
address
bc1qm5sz3qveuvu8mhea3zg4mzh60yl8sa7x4hr8a9
transaction
5e189999c981d54ac553076f887d24b7a196415bde28d3e26c02fd0467921f9e
confirmations
370097
spent
true